Your future role

Take on a new challenge and apply your strategic and operational expertise in a cutting-edge field. You'll work alongside collaborative and forward-thinking teammates.

You'll play a pivotal role in defining, planning, and executing the full suite of supply chain processes for our Thunder Bay site, including industrial planning, materials planning, and logistics operations. Day-to-day, you'll work closely with teams across the business (e.g., regional supply chain, site management, and project committees), lead the implementation of supply chain strategies, and ensure operational excellence across all processes.

You'll specifically take care of managing the Sales & Operations Planning (S&OP) and Master Production Schedule (MPS) processes, but also support projects in achieving Quality, Cost, and Delivery (QCD) commitments.

We'll look to you for:
  • Adapting and deploying supply chain strategies in alignment with regional and local goals
  • Implementing and managing standards, processes, methods, and tools for supply chain operations
  • Identifying site-specific needs and contributing to the development of transversal processes and tools
  • Building and deploying a targeted organizational structure and people development roadmap
  • Ensuring compliance with Alstom Health, Safety, and Environmental policies
  • Preparing and managing budgets while identifying opportunities for improvement and synergy
  • Driving performance through KPI management and process reviews
  • Providing support to stabilize or mobilize supply chain operations in emerging sites or new business areas

About Alstom Power Inc

Alstom Power Inc. is a provider of power generation equipment and services for the energy industry. The company offers a range of products and services, including gas turbines, steam turbines, generators, and environmental control systems. Alstom Power Inc. is a subsidiary of Alstom SA, a French multinational company that specializes in the production of transport and energy infrastructure. The company was founded in 1928 and is headquartered in Windsor, Connecticut. Alstom Power Inc. has operations in North America, Europe, and Asia, and serves customers in the power generation, transmission, and distribution sectors.
